Pangang Steel Vanadium & Titanium to triple net profit in Q1

Monday, 16 April 2012 14:49:39 (GMT+3)   |  
       

Sichuan Province-based Chinese steelmaker Pangang Group has announced that its subsidiary Steel Vanadium & Titanium Co. is expected to record a net profit of RMB 500-550 million ($79.19-87.11 million) for the first quarter of the current year, up 322-364 percent year on year. Earnings per share are expected to be in the range of RMB 0.09-0.10 ($0.0143-0.0158).

In the same period last year, the net profit of Steel Vanadium & Titanium Co. totaled RMB 118.55 million ($18.78 million).
